About Crusoe Energy Systems LLC

Crusoe Energy Systems is building Crusoe Cloud, an AI cloud platform that provides managed AI services and AI data center infrastructure. They cater to businesses seeking to accelerate AI solution development with optimized models and high-performance computing. The company utilizes environmentally aligned power sources, including wind, solar, and natural gas, to power its data centers. With features like managed Kubernetes and Slurm, Crusoe simplifies operations and ensures reliability with 24/7 support. Crusoe is expanding its reach, including a strategic European expansion with its first data center in Norway. Crusoe recently raised $1.375 billion at a valuation above $10 billion.
